An Israeli politician has been sent what is believed to be a diamond ring by a secret admirer, according to a source.
Tzipi Livni, the Israeli foreign minister, received the item from a Canadian through the post, reports Earthtimes.org.
In news which may interest owners of platinum or gold diamond rings, the 18-carat band was sent from Quebec, along with a letter stating "I'm aware of myself" and a photograph of the sender, the news provider states.
Ms Livni, who is married with two children, told members of her staff to return the ring with a thank you note.
It has not yet been determined whether the item is a genuine gold diamond ring, the news source continues.
